Hamster Endurance Runs

Bellingham, United States • 1 Aug 2026

Event Details

The Hamster Endurance Runs takes place in Bellingham, Washington. The course is a 2.6-mile loop around Lake Padden. The loop is described as a wide, non-technical gravel path with 150 feet of elevation gain per loop. The event features multiple timed race categories.

Race Categories

Participants can choose from several timed events:

  • 32-hour run
  • 24-hour run
  • 12-hour run
  • 6-hour run

Course and Atmosphere

The course runs through classic Pacific Northwest forests. The event promises a fun aid station atmosphere with experienced volunteers. Runners who complete 100 miles within their chosen time category will receive a belt buckle.

Event Organizer and Charity

The event is organized by Walla Trails & Community, which was formed to continue this event. A portion of the entry fees will be donated to support the Whatcom Family YMCA's Girls on the Run program and its scholarship fund.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
